Newton’s Third Law of Motion – Action and Reaction Forces
439.7K views on YouTube
This physics video tutorial explains the basic concept of newton’s third law of motion. It contains plenty of examples demonstrating newton’s 3rd law of motion in action as well as a few practice problems calculating force, mass, and acceleration. Newton’s third law states that for every action force, there is an equal but opposite reaction force. So action and reaction forces have the same magnitude but are opposite in direction.
